title = "Effect of solvents on electrical properties of PEDOT:PSS/n-Si heterojunction diodes",
abstract = "Effect of organic polar solvents on the morphology and electrical properties of Poly(3,4-ethylenedioxythiophene)-poly(styrenesulfonate) (PEDOT:PSS) films have been investigated. PEDOT:PSS has been deposited on n-type silicon wafer using spin coating process. The best result was obtained with co-solvents. The conductivity increased from 0.16 S/cm for pristine to 30 S/cm for co-solvents. All prepared films are highly transparent and fabricated heterojunction diodes show rectifying behavior.",
